Astera Labs, Inc. (ALAB) is a semiconductor connectivity company serving cloud and artificial-intelligence infrastructure. Its Intelligent Connectivity Platform combines integrated circuits, controllers, sensors, boards, modules, and software for data, network, and memory connections in advanced computing systems. Customers include hyperscale cloud providers and equipment manufacturers building AI servers and data-center platforms.
